


About the Role
This Grow Out Manager will oversee the grow-out process. This is a strong support role for growers and field servicing. This position is a critical team member of management, and supplies reporting and communication that is essential for a successful performance plan.
Key Activities
Oversees all field service technician functions to optimise flock health and performance. Provide all essential training and advisory support to service techs for success in their positions. Coordinate career enrichment training programs. Perform annual performance appraisal evaluations of the service group to set and ensure that goals are being met.
Coordinate weekly with consulting veterinarian and nutritionist to support company objectives.
Communicates daily with staff, management, and growers.
Approves all drug, cleaning and disinfection suppliers.
Oversees inventory control of the warehouse.
Assists in setting and adhering to the required budget, meeting all financial targets. Identifies and implements cost savings.
Generates, maintains, and distributes various reports as needed, such as mortalities, placements, costings, and field performance.
Ensures that sales needs are being met.
Attend management meetings as needed, updating and addressing any issues.
Assists growers with equipment upgrades and housing profits, and serves as a strong contact for growers with any issues.
Creates, implements, and directs critical Grow Out programs, including the Grower Performance Improvement plan.
Ensures animal welfare policies are met, along with documented annual training for all growers and live personnel.

Education and Experience
Bachelor’s Degree (four-year college or university)
Must have four to ten years of related experience
Needs a strong background in poultry education, with extensive knowledge of poultry house ventilation, essential poultry diseases, and Biosecurity and Animal Welfare procedures.
